The invention designs a civil aircraft four-cabin three-dimensional monitoring system based on Internet of Things perception. The civil aircraft four-cabin three-dimensional monitoring system comprises data acquisition equipment, an airborne service system, an airborne control end, a ground control end and a data communication link. The data acquisition equipment is used for acquiring monitoring data of the four cabins in real time; the airborne service system is used for data storage, processing and intelligent analysis and calculation; the onboard control end is used for sending a control signal and displaying a four-cabin monitoring video, a video sharpening processing result and an abnormal event detection result; the ground control end is used for receiving the abnormal event internet-of-things data in real time; and the data communication link is used for establishing communication connection among the modules. According to the invention, three-dimensional monitoring of the whole flight process and the whole cabin of the civil aircraft can be realized, the application shortages of a flight data recorder and a cockpit voice recorder can be effectively made up, intelligent detection and alarm of civil aviation safety accidents can be realized, and a new technical means is provided for civil aviation safety accidents' in-event intervention and post-event evidence collection '.
